ADS1203IPWR Equivalent & Substitute Parts

Part Overview

The ADS1203IPWR is a 16-bit modulator integrated circuit manufactured by Texas Instruments, designed for data acquisition applications requiring serial interface communication. This device operates as a single-channel modulator with a 40 kHz sampling rate and single supply voltage operation between 4.75V and 5.25V.

The ADS1203IPWR carries an Obsolete product status. Identifying equivalent and substitute parts is necessary to ensure design continuity, maintain supply chain reliability, and support long-term product availability for applications currently utilizing this component.

Engineering Selection Recommendations

The ADS1202IPWR is the appropriate substitute for the obsolete ADS1203IPWR based on the following engineering criteria:

Product Status and Supply Chain: The ADS1202IPWR maintains Active product status with significantly higher inventory availability (2876 pieces in stock versus 844 pieces for the ADS1203IPWR). This ensures reliable long-term supply for new designs and production continuity.

Electrical and Functional Equivalence: Both devices are electrically identical across all critical data acquisition parameters: 16-bit resolution, 40 kHz sampling rate, single-channel configuration, serial data interface, and 4.75V to 5.25V supply voltage operation.

Compliance and Environmental Ratings: Both parts maintain ROHS3 compliance and MSL Level 1 moisture sensitivity ratings, ensuring equivalent reliability and environmental performance in manufacturing and field deployment.

Operating Temperature Consideration: The ADS1202IPWR specifies an operating temperature range of -40°C to 85°C, compared to -40°C to 125°C for the ADS1203IPWR. Applications requiring operation above 85°C must evaluate thermal requirements against the substitute device's maximum rated temperature.

Package Compatibility: Identical 8-TSSOP package specifications ensure direct physical and electrical compatibility on existing printed circuit board layouts without design modification.
